This position sits within the **Health Independence Program (HIP) **suite of services that are delivered across St Vincent’s Health Melbourne (SVHM) and North Richmond Community Health (NRCH). Post Acute Care is funded by Department of Health and assists clients to recuperate at home following discharge from a public hospital.

**About the Opportunity**

NRCH has an exciting opportunity for a registered nurse or registered allied health clinician. The **Care Coordinator (fixed-term 0.8-1.0 EFT) **will provide support to clients in the post discharge period and assist them navigate the service system.

The PAC program has a flexible service delivery model enabling the program to provide a responsive service which includes purchasing a wide range of health and community services and provision of clinical care by program staff when necessary.

**More specifically, some of your responsibilities will include**:

- Intake, screening and assessment;
- Liaising with clients, their carers/families, hospital clinicians and other community service providers;
- Developing care plans with clients, engaging / contracting a range of clinical and in home support services;
- Provision of clinical services when required
- Developing and maintaining strong networks with hospital clinicians, community service providers and neighbouring other Health Independence Programs

**Key Selection Criteria**:

- AHPRA registration - registered nurse or allied health clinician with significant experience working within the health and/or community services sector.
- Experience working with people with complex issues in a health setting (including homelessness, drug & alcohol, mental health, dementia, refugee and migrant communities), and the proven ability to work with people from CALD (culturally and linguistically diverse) backgrounds.
- an enthusiastic, highly organised team player with a strong knowledge of the community services available to clients in the recuperative phase.
- To ensure the smooth provision of services to clients, you will have demonstrated ability to identify issues, problem solve, be an effective communicator with a wide range of stakeholders and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
- You must have excellent computer skills including MS Office suite.
- Current Victorian Driver’s Licence

Please note it is a requirement for all employees of North Richmond Community Health to demonstrate evidence of mandatory immunisations/vaccinations prior to commencement of employment, based on the Immunisation Category this position falls under this includes 3 doses COVID-19 vaccine and the annual influenza vaccine.
